The Hengst 11.0065 PWR10-C00-0-M (1010573B) is a high-performance hydraulic filter element designed to ensure optimal filtration in hydraulic systems. This filter element plays a crucial role in maintaining the cleanliness and efficiency of hydraulic fluids by effectively removing contaminants. It features a multilayer glass fiber material with a filter media code of PWR, providing excellent retention capacity and dirt holding capacity while minimizing pressure loss. The filter's nominal size is 0065, and it includes a support cage made from standard materials, ensuring durability under various operating conditions. With dimensions of 204 mm in length, an outer diameter of 46 mm, and an inner diameter of 19.9 mm, this filter element is compact yet robust enough to handle demanding applications. It has a collapse pressure rating of 160 bar, indicating its ability to withstand high-pressure environments without compromising performance. The seal designation for this model is NBR, known for its resistance to oils and fuels, making it suitable for use in hydraulic systems where such fluids are prevalent. The Hengst 11.0065 PWR10-C00-0-M is not suitable for HFC or HFA applications and does not conform to DIN24550 standards. Its design class as a filter element ensures that it can be integrated seamlessly into existing filtration setups without requiring additional support cages or modifications. The Filter Element is the central component in a filter, where the actual filtration takes place. The key filter parameters such as retention capacity, dirt holding capacity and pressure loss are determined by the Filter Element and the filter media used.
